Да забыл добавить __C_task отбивает у финкции желание сохранять регистры(+)
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)
Поэтому надо поосторожней, если не выходите за рабочие регистры r0-r3; r16-r23; r30-r31 то все ОК.А если ... то прийдется в "void InterruptRoutine(void)" сохранять доп. регистры вручную.
Составить ответ
|||
Конференция
|||
Архив
Ответы
Перейти к списку ответов
|||
Конференция
|||
Архив
|||
Главная страница
|||
Содержание
|||
Без кадра
E-mail:
info@telesys.ru